Rawalpindi: Accountability courts has indicted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f’s (PTI) founder Imran Khan and his wife Bushra Bibi in 190-million-pound reference case.
According to the details, judge Nasir Javed Rana heard the case in Adiala jail. National Accountability Bureau’s (NAB) deputy prosecutor Sardar Muzaffar Abbasi appeared with his team in the court.
However, judge Nasir Javed Rana indicted PTI’s founder and Bushra Bibi in this case. The judge read the indictment against Bushra Bibi and Imran Khan in 190-million-pound case.
The 58 testimony of witnesses will be recorded in this case. The court summoned 5 accusers on March 6.
It is important to mention here that the court postponed the case by March 6.
